We talked with Julian Strother and Christian Brown today at Nuggets practice. The biggest thing they talked about is the clutch. Nuggets have been this awesome clutch team throughout the entire Jokic era. They've been awful in the clutch in the last five minutes of the season.
Harrison Wind 0:38
They've been OK on offense, but just awful on defense.

Harrison Wind 0:41
And those guys said, we just have to lock in. We know we're a better clutch team than this. What we've been doing is so uncharacteristic of the Denver Nuggets in the Jokic era. We've got to get to our spots. We've got to be more physical, and we've just got to execute and stop turning the ball over. That's what David Adelman said as well. He's so frustrated right now by the turnovers, by just the undisciplined, by how weird and off the Nuggets have been in the clutch. It's a big point of emphasis for these guys. It's something they're definitely focusing in on because they know they're a better clutch team than they are right now, and they've got to be if they're going to be serious about making a deep playoff run.
Harrison Wind 1:21
Another point of emphasis for the Nuggets right now is on the defensive side of the floor. They've been an awful defense for most of the season. They've been ranked in the 20s defensively for this entire year. That's pretty much along with all the other tanking teams. The message from the Nuggets right now is we've got to be more physical. We've got to be more disciplined. also very similar to where they're falling short in the clutch. They've just got to lock in, pay better attention to game plan, discipline, and just be more physical and get up into guys more defensively.

We talk about the Nuggets five days a week. This is your spot for Denver Nuggets talk. Aaron Gordon, he's been ramping up, participated in a lot of practice today, like he has been recently. He actually stayed back, if you notice, during this last Nuggets road trip to rehab more. He is getting closer. I think Peyton Watson's a little further behind Aaron Gordon, but AG definitely seems somewhat close to returning. Today at practice, he went through everything except the contact drills. Went through a lot of defensive stuff, a lot of drill work.
Harrison Wind 2:53
He's just not doing contact yet at Nuggets practice. But I will say him staying back on that recent three game road trip where the Nuggets went one and two and dropped just some really bad losses at the Clippers. That clutch loss to Golden State may be the worst of the season. They obviously could use Aaron Gordon in these spots and the team's very cognizant of that. David Edelman said even today, the clutch time offense and defense, it's just not the same when Aaron Gordon's not out there, and that's obviously true. Him staying back, though, during that road trip, I think that means he's close. Maybe not going to play this next game, but it doesn't seem like he's that far off from returning pretty soon.
